**Alert: autocomplete-index-latency-high**

The Quickfind suggestion index is returning p95 latencies above 400ms, usually caused by a stale segment merge or an oversized prefix shard. Check merge queue depth before assuming a query regression. Reviewers touching the tokenizer should note this alert's thresholds are tuned to current segment sizes. Report false positives to the Search platform team at the address below.

alerts address for tafog-tagef: casath@qorvellabs.corp

## Escalation: GC Pauses in Matchwell

So Matchwell is pausing again. First, confirm it's actually GC — check the pause-time graph, not just latency. Pauses under 2s that self-recover: note it, move on. Sustained pauses or match timeouts piling up: bump the heap flag per the tuning doc and restart one node at a time. If that doesn't settle things within 15 minutes, or you're seeing full-heap collections back to back, loop in the runtime team — they'd rather hear early.

escalation mailbox, bafog-fafog: ulador@paliqlabs.internal

## Authentication

The LagWatch alarm fires when any read replica in the Quillstream cluster falls more than 30 seconds behind the primary. New team members should note that acknowledging or silencing this alarm requires an authenticated call to the Beaconette service; unauthenticated requests are dropped silently, which can look like the alarm is stuck. Always verify your token scope includes `alarms:write` before paging anyone. For local development and staging, use the shared team credential issued below.

app token of yajeg-kawef = kto11_7En3XSX8xQw

Ticket: Slim the Pellworth API container image. Current image is 1.4 GB; target under 400 MB. Move to the distroless base, drop build toolchains from the final stage, and prune locale data. New contractors: don't remove the healthcheck binary — the orchestrator needs it. Verify startup and smoke tests still pass. Size comparison was measured on the build shown below.

pipeline stamp: htk9_ce63042d9